Output 98696e51496c5c7d743db78734e3bbb602d6283adba660742e9016fd1ea3dde0:7

value
22245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34170adc2a1f870f61ae30a65c71bc6f1c68667f OP_EQUAL
address
36SSfXxF7zZW6ifhcch5nKK2nmAH6LXAqA
transaction
98696e51496c5c7d743db78734e3bbb602d6283adba660742e9016fd1ea3dde0
spent
true